The Studio Energy is not just packed with beautiful hardware on the inside, it also has a premium build that is evident upon first look. Say goodbye to the anxiety of looking at your battery indicator. The industry leading Studio Energy packs a 5000 mAh battery which can last up to 96 hours with standard usage or 45 days stand by time. Also reverses charges to serve as a power bank. Enjoy it all from the 5.0" HD screen with 720 x 1280 resolution covered by a protective layer of Corning Gorilla Glass 3 to make sure your screen is protected from all of life's hazards. This premium device is powered by a 1.3GHz Quad Core Processor and 1GB of RAM. The main shooter is an 8MP Main Camera and 2MP on the front for selfies.
Q: What size SIM card does it use? does it work on LTE networks?
A: It uses a micro SIM. It does not work on LTE networks, only HSPA+.
